Hi,

 

just wanted your experiences and ideas about geocoinclubs (e.g. geocoinclub.com). I was wondering whether it would be interesting to join it, but I hardly see any advantage in it. Even with the largest subscription (25 coins/month), you would still pay over $10 per coin. That's more than what I see in these forums or in other shops?

 

Do I miss something, because, of course, it is very rare to have a subscription with 25 coins/month. The most "interesting" subscriptions for me would be 1 per month and a 12 month subscription, still meaning $14 per coin?!?

Too bad companies don't offer those of us that are loyal buyers an incentive program. We see this all the time whether coins or phones or anything else. If you are a new customer you get great deals but if you are a loyal customer you just get what you signed up for years ago.

 

IF you started "years ago" when the per month cost was $10.00 and you're still at it, you're getting about $48.00 this year (using the OPs $14.00 per month figure) in the way of an incentive. Plus, you can buy the left over back issues for $10.00 or $12.00 and shipping.

 

My thing with the coin clubs is that though most of their coins are great, they crank out a clinker occasionally. You can always tell because there's an influx of last months coins showing up on Ebay. So, you get some great coins, but you're going to eat some clinkers which (in my opinion) elevates your per coin cost dramatically. And, yes, you could sell them on Ebay, but you're going head to head with GCC and some individuals of their group PLUS any other GCC club members who don't like their coin. So you're trying to get your $14.00 back for a coin that's selling for $11 to $13.

 

So if you're in, there's 'incentive" to stay in, but it's pretty tough to jump in today betting that the market's going to continue to increase and GCC is going to remain viable long enough for a person to get to the point where you might be right now. I've been collecting geocoins for nearly two years now and have seen at least four vendors disappear (Castle, A&E, CoinSwag, TnT) and I'm starting to be concerned about C&P. They've had the same note up for over two months now and their stock's starting to disappear from the stores of their listed re-sellers.
